About Us | Testimonial | Partner | Support | Contact us
Sales Inquiry:
sales@sparkstation.net
Call Us: +65 6826 0588

Introduction
Today’s IT organizations are dealing with the consequences of exploding IT infrastructure growth and complexity. While computing resources continue to increase in power, organizations are unable to fully utilize them in single application deployments and cannot change computing resource assignments easily when application or business requirements change. At the root of the problem is uncontrolled server sprawl, servers provisioned to support a single application. Organizations that implemented hardware virtualization have unwittingly created a new problem: OS sprawl. While hardware remains a considerable cost component, software and management continue to be the largest cost considerations. The daily management and operations functions are daunting, and adding in business continuity requirements, the costs and complexity are overwhelming. Moreover, few tools provide the management and automation to ease the burden on IT departments.
In order to address these critical challenges, IT organizations have to find ways to accomplish the following:
Improve the flexibility of computing resource assignment
Decrease complexity to improve manageability of systems
Automate routine tasks
Reduce overall management costs through efficiency
Provide cost-effective data availability and recovery
Increase the return from their infrastructure investment by better utilizing resources
Operating-system level virtualization and Virtuozzo empower IT organizations to meet these challenges and the increasing demands on IT infrastructure.
VIRTUOZZO OVERVIEW
Virtuozzo is an operating system level server virtualization solution. Virtuozzo creates isolated partitions or virtual environments (VEs) on a single physical server and OS instance to utilize hardware, software, data center and management efforts with maximum efficiency.
Virtuozzo’s OS virtualization solution has higher efficiency and manageability, making it the best solution for organizations concerned with containing the IT infrastructure and maximizing resource utilization. Virtuozzo’s complete set of management tools and unique architecture makes it the perfect solution for easily maintaining, monitoring and managing virtualized server resources for consolidation and business continuity configurations.
The Virtuozzo low-overhead, efficient architecture maximizes server resources. SWsoft created a portable layer to existing operating systems which adds a dynamic partition or Virtual Environment (VE) that resides on a common OS. The single thin Virtuozzo layer introduces only a small percentage of overhead and allows up to 100s of VEs to run on a physical server. This architecture allows a much more flexible, efficient and cost-effective solution for server management.
The enhanced design of the virtualization technology also enables any VE on any network to be easily and transparently moved to another server with near-zero downtime, enabling IT departments to more fully utilize existing servers and minimize or eliminate planned downtime.

PERFORMANCE
Virtuozzo’s unique form of virtualization not only eliminates complications that arise with hardware virtual¬ization, but its impact on server performance is so minimal that the server operates at near-native levels. The performance factors include:
System Calls
Virtuozzo has a common kernel, no additional systems calls are created between excess layers.
Filesystem
Common data is stored only once and is available to multiple environments, significantly improving the efficiency of both the disk space and system memory. The disk space for caching is also used efficiently, caching payload rather than duplicated data.
Filesystem Performance
Virtuozzo’s filesystem and efficient system call design create very small CPU usage overhead.
Filesystem buffers/cache in memory
Virtuozzo places a single instance of data and cache across the server, maximizing memory efficiency.
Memory Management
Virtuozzo handles memory allocation requests dynamically. Virtuozzo environments can use a lot of memory during load peaks, and users will fully benefit from running Virtuozzo on high-end servers. Applications in Virtuozzo environments can show very high peak per¬formance. Also, when environment resource demand grows gradually in time, Virtuozzo’s dynamic resource management allows increasing the resource allocation with no downtime.
ADVANTAGES
![]() |
Server Consolidation and OS Consolidation Virtuozzo takes consolidation a step further by consolidating OSs for easy management and reducing costs and complexity while improving service levels. Virtuozzo provides full isolation between applications and its lean architecture allows a high server density. The unique Virtuozzo architecture further accelerates the cost savings by reducing software licensing and support costs and through extensive management tools that help automate server management tasks. |
![]() |
Business Continuity Virtuozzo migration capabilities allow VEs to be moved in real-time with near-0 downtime (keeping the application available through the migration until the last few seconds), and no SAN is required. |
![]() |
Centralized Desktop Management IT organizations are centralizing desktop applications and making them available from virtualized servers. These virtualized applications are available on servers and are accessible to end users to provide a secure, controlled and manageable environment. Applications can be created and deployed in secure virtual environments which prevent viruses from spreading over computers. Applications are centralized for easy updates and ongoing management. |
![]() |
Dynamic Workload Management |
Virtuozzo VS Hardware Virtualization
Hardware virtualization has its benefits. At least on the leading market solution, just about any operating system is supported. It is possible to load Windows next Linux next to Solaris, and it still supports older OSs. Despite the benefits, the flexibility of this type of solution comes with a lot of overhead and inefficiencies.
Many organizations find that after deploying a hardware virtualization solution, they loaded an entire server with virtual machines all running the same operating system. This happens for a variety of reaŽsons, mainly because most organizations have enough servers to consolidate like operating systems and the system administrator supporting the server has the skill set of that OS. Suddenly, that goal of loading any operating system on a single server doesn't warrant the associated overhead of this type of flexibility.
Further limitations inherent to hardware virtualization lead to additional overheads and inefficiencies, as addressed in the following points:
As an OS-level virtualization solution, Virtuozzo uses a single standard Operating System on a server. Not only does this model eliminate the inefficiencies of hardware virtualization, but there are advantages inherent to this approach
- Virtuozzo uses all of the real hardware and OS software. There are no rewritten drivers or OS technology. There is also very little or no delay in supporting new technologies and it performs at near-native server levels.
- There is no duplicate OS, so it again performs very efficiently.
- Because of the near native server performance, Virtuozzo is used to virtualize high I/O applications such as data bases and email servers.
- The flexible design allows any VE to seamlessly scale to the resources of the entire server.
- The lean architecture ensures that nearly all of the system resources are available for use by VEs.
- Virtuozzo fully supports native 2 bit and bit systems, 1CPUs SMP support and GB RAM on the host as well in as in VEs.
4. Manageability
There is only a single OS to manage, maintain and license. Even if OS vendors forget they are managing the hardware below rather than the applications above, and change their licensing models, the management savings will make the extra licensing costs worthwhile.
Application management may also be centralized and managed as a single instance.
One update can patch multiple VEs on multiple servers.
Many operations are automated and scriptable, making management of many servers and VEs simple.
OSs and other software can be created in a VE as simple links making the footprint small operations extremely fast. For example, a VE is created in seconds, and clones or migrations take less time because only the active or different data is moved rather than an entire operating system.
The comprehensive resource management ensures that all required resources are provided as configured for each VE. It also allows VEs to use available resources and make changes in near real-time.



For any query or questions . Please email sales@sparkstation.net